Well I don't think a plugin host can ever do the right thing unless
it is AMB aware itself. For a multichannel compressor the gain has to
be the same in all channels, AMB or not. So you can't just replicate a
mono plugin. For the compressor I'm developing, in AMB mode only the W
channel affects the gain. A host can't arrange that, unless 1) the
compressor is multichannel by design and 2) it has a separate detector
(sidechain) input and 3) the host allows you to send just one channel
of a multichannel track to that special input. Maybe A3 can do that.
But it would just cover this simple case. It's much easier to provide
the function *inside* the plugin.
